WebWhen you install a program in Linux it is most often configured to just work. So you would do service postgresql start to start it, service postgresql stop to stop, and service postgresql status to check if it's working etc. You may need to set it up that it will start automatically on boot. WebNov 22, 2024 · To start the default or primary PostgreSQL server on your system, simply run the following command: systemctl start postgresql The above command should work on all major Linux distributions.
